Last night a friend came over and I showed her how to make a stair step card. She had never made one of these before so it was fun teaching her how to do it. She immediately saw a good use for the ScorPal she bought recently too!

The instructions for this card can be found at Split Coast Stampers .

I used a nice light green scrapbooking paper for the fronts of the "stairs". I punched borders in white card for the lace effect and layered with the green paper.

I cut the scalloped circles with my Cuttlebug - (nestabilities dies). Because the lower one was 1/4 inch wider than the smaller one, I decided to minimise the effect of too much white by edging it with an aqua coloured ink pad, which turned out quite well. The flower was one I picked up (as a bag of 10 ) from one of the local $2 shops. Sometimes they have some great bargains for crafting!

The ribbon was added to provide a little contrast.
